Main Page | Class Hierarchy | Class List | Directories | File List | Class Members | File Members

geostat.h File Reference


Typedefs

typedef enum channel_enum channel_t
typedef enum geostat_err_enum geostat_err_t

Enumerations

enum  channel_enum { GEOSTAT_CHNL_IR = 1, GEOSTAT_CHNL_VIS = 2, GEOSTAT_CHNL_WV = 3 }
enum  geostat_err_enum { GEOSTAT_ERR_OK = 0, GEOSTAT_ERR_OUT_OF_RANGE = -1, GEOSTAT_ERR_BAD_INIT = -2, GEOSTAT_ERR_BAD_INPUT_COORD = -3 }

Functions

geostat_err_t geostat_init (const char *satellite)
geostat_err_t geostat_latlon_to_lincol_double (double latitude, double longitude, double *line, double *column)
geostat_err_t geostat_lincol_to_latlon_double (double line, double column, double *latitude, double *longitude)
geostat_err_t geostat_latlon_to_lincol (const double latitude, const double longitude, unsigned long *line, unsigned long *column)
geostat_err_t geostat_lincol_to_latlon (const unsigned long line, const unsigned long column, double *latitude, double *longitude)
geostat_err_t geostat_get_azimut_and_zenithal (const double latitude, const double longitude, double *azimut, double *zenithal)

Typedef Documentation

typedef enum channel_enum channel_t
 

typedef enum geostat_err_enum geostat_err_t
 


Enumeration Type Documentation

enum channel_enum
 

Enumeration values:
GEOSTAT_CHNL_IR 
GEOSTAT_CHNL_VIS 
GEOSTAT_CHNL_WV 

enum geostat_err_enum
 

Enumeration values:
GEOSTAT_ERR_OK 
GEOSTAT_ERR_OUT_OF_RANGE 
GEOSTAT_ERR_BAD_INIT 
GEOSTAT_ERR_BAD_INPUT_COORD 


Function Documentation

geostat_err_t geostat_get_azimut_and_zenithal const double  latitude,
const double  longitude,
double *  azimut,
double *  zenithal
 

geostat_err_t geostat_init const char *  satellite  ) 
 

geostat_err_t geostat_latlon_to_lincol const double  latitude,
const double  longitude,
unsigned long *  line,
unsigned long *  column
 

geostat_err_t geostat_latlon_to_lincol_double double  latitude,
double  longitude,
double *  line,
double *  column
 

geostat_err_t geostat_lincol_to_latlon const unsigned long  line,
const unsigned long  column,
double *  latitude,
double *  longitude
 

geostat_err_t geostat_lincol_to_latlon_double double  line,
double  column,
double *  latitude,
double *  longitude
 


Generated on Wed Apr 19 17:05:06 2006 for Remap by  doxygen 1.3.9.1